How Our Attic Water Removal Process Works
When you call us for Attic Water Removal, our team will send a certified technician to your home to assess the situation and provide a detailed estimate.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from your attic, and then dry and dehumidify the area to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We’ll send a certified technician to inspect your attic and assess the situation. They’ll identify the source of the leak, find out the extent of the damage, and provide a detailed estimate for the work needed to restore your attic to its original condition.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once we’ve identified the source of the leak and the extent of the damage, our technician will use specialized equipment to extract the water from your attic. This may involve using a wet/dry vacuum, a submersible pump, or other equipment to remove the water quickly and efficiently.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ted from your attic, our technician will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the area. This may involve using air movers, dehumidifiers, and other equipment to remove any remaining moisture and prevent further damage and m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area has been dried and dehumidified, our technician will clean and sanitize the area to remove any remaining debris, dust, and contaminants. This will help prevent further damage and ensure your attic is safe and healthy for you and your family.

Attic Water Removal Cost In Saratoga, NY
The cost of Attic Water Removal in Saratoga, NY,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services related to Attic Water Remov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ed to extract the water.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the length of time required to complete the process.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ning and sanitizing required. |
